引言
在现代网络环境中,代理工具如 Clash 被广泛使用,以���助用户实现更好的网络访问体验。然而,有时用户会遇到 Clash 不走代理 IP 的问题,这可能会导致无法访问某些网站或服务。本文将深入探讨这一问题的原因及其解决方案。
什么是 Clash?
Clash 是一款功能强大的代理工具,支持多种协议,如 Shadowsocks、Vmess 等。它能够帮助用户在不同的网络环境中实现科学上网,保护用户的隐私。
Clash 不走代理 IP 的常见原因
1. 配置文件错误
- 配置文件格式不正确:Clash 的配置文件需要遵循特定的格式,任何小的错误都可能导致代理无法正常工作。
- 未正确设置代理规则:如果代理规则未正确配置,Clash 可能会选择不走代理 IP。
2. 网络环境问题
- DNS 解析问题:如果 DNS 设置不正确,可能会导致 Clash 无法正确解析目标网站的 IP 地址。
- 防火墙或安全软件干扰:某些防火墙或安全软件可能会阻止 Clash 的网络请求。
3. Clash 版本问题
- 软件版本过旧:使用过时的 Clash 版本可能会导致兼容性问题,影响代理功能。
- 未及时更新配置:Clash 的配置文件需要定期更新,以确保能够正常使用最新的代理节点。
如何解决 Clash 不走代理 IP 的问题
1. 检查配置文件
- 验证配置文件格式:使用在线工具检查配置文件的格式是否正确。
- 确保代理规则设置正确:仔细检查代理规则,确保目标网站的流量能够通过代理。
2. 优化网络设置
- 更改 DNS 设置:尝试使用公共 DNS,如 Google DNS(8.8.8.8)或 Cloudflare DNS(1.1.1.1)。
- 检查防火墙设置:确保防火墙或安全软件未阻止 Clash 的网络请求。
3. 更新 Clash 版本
- 下载最新版本:访问 Clash 的官方网站,下载并安装最新版本。
- 更新配置文件:定期检查并更新配置文件,以确保使用最新的代理节点。
常见问题解答(FAQ)
Q1: Clash 不走代理 IP 的原因是什么?
A1: 可能的原因包括配置文件错误、网络环境问题、DNS 解析问题以及 Clash 版本过旧等。
Q2: 如何检查 Clash 的配置文件?
A2: 可以使用文本编辑器打开配置文件,检查格式是否正确,并确保代理规则设置无误。
Q3: Clash 的代理规则如何设置?
A3: 代理规则可以在配置文件中通过 rules
字段进行设置,确保目标网站的流量能够通过代理。
Q4: 如何更改 DNS 设置?
A4: 可以在网络设置中找到 DNS 配置,手动输入公共 DNS 地址,如 Google DNS(8.8.8.8)。
Q5: Clash 如何更新?
A5: 可以访问 Clash 的官方网站,下载最新版本并进行安装,或者使用命令行工具进行更新。
结论
在使用 Clash 时,遇到不走代理 IP 的问题并不罕见。通过检查配置文件、优化网络设置和更新软件版本,用户可以有效解决这一问题,确保网络访问的顺畅。希望本文能为您提供有价值的帮助。
正文完